CJP seeks SJC member's opinion on complaints against Justice Naqvi.

Chief Justice of Pakistan Justice Umar Ata BanAdial Wednesday sought an opinion of the SuApreme Judicial Council (SJC) member regarding the complaints against Supreme Court Judge JusAtice Sayyed Mazahar Ali Akbar Naqvi on charges of misconduct.
